Je mi jasné, že ne každý chce utratit spoustu peněz za nové úložiště svých dat, a tak jsem se začal zajímat o to, do jaké míry by se dalo urychlit spouštění operačního systému na počítači, aniž bych musel utratit jedinou korunu. Po několika hodinách ladění a testování se mi podařilo snížit dobu načítání operačního systému v počítači z 69 sekund na 47 sekund. Zajímá vás, jak se mi to podařilo? Pak čtěte dále…
1. díl článku: testovací počítač, proces spouštění operačního systému
2. díl článku: zákaz spouštění externích služeb
3. díl článku: zákaz aplikací spouštějících se při startu OS, vyladění BIOSu
4. díl článku: vyčištění registru
5. díl článku: změna doby zobrazení spouštěcí nabídky, závěr
Změna doby zobrazení spouštěcí nabídky
Možná byste řekli, že změna doby zobrazování spouštěcí nabídky nebude mít na dobu spouštění operačního systému žádný výrazný vliv, protože se v podstatě jedná pouze o to, jak dlouho mají Windows zobrazovat spouštěcí nabídku, jako je kupříkladu nabídka pro obnovu systému. Ukazuje se však, že změna doby zobrazení spouštěcí nabídky ovlivňuje i dobu načítání operačního systému.
Na mém testovacím počítači byla jako výchozí doba pro zobrazení spouštěcí nabídky použita hodnota 30 sekund, nicméně na případnou reakci uživatele ve spouštěcí nabídce by mělo stačit i 10 sekund. Doba spouštění počítače se po této úpravě zkrátila o další 3 sekundy, takže spouštění systému trvalo pouhých 47 sekund.
Tento test jsem opakoval několikrát se stejným výsledkem. Osobně mi není sice vůbec jasné, proč úprava této hodnoty má relativně tak velký dopad na dobu spouštění operačního systému, ale 3 sekundy jsou 3 sekundy.
Na závěr
Dobu spouštění operačního systému se můžete pokusit zkracovat i dále – stačí, když se budete každému z mnou navržených kroků věnovat ještě o něco hlouběji. Nicméně je jasně vidět, že s minimální námahou se dosáhlo zkrácení doby spouštění operačního systému z 69 sekund na 47 sekund, což představuje více než 30 procent.
Další možností je obětovat na zkrácení doby spouštění operačního sytému nějaké ty peníze. Množství vynaložených peněz závisí na operačním systému, který používáte. V mém vylepšeném počítači využívajícím SSD RAID se spustí počítač do 30 sekund, a to bez nutnosti nasazení některého z tipů, který jsem v tomto článku zmínil. Nebo pokud máte počítač se Sandy Bridge a čipovou sadou Intel Z68, můžete do počítače přidat menší SSD disk (o velikosti 64 GB, klidně i méně) a povolit u SSD disku použití vyrovnávací paměťi (caching). Tímto způsobem se významně zkrátí doba spouštění počítače a zároveň se zkrátí i doba spouštění aplikací.
Dobu spouštění operačního systému můžete podstatně zkrátit dokonce i u klasických počítačů. Klíčem je postupné optimalizování každého kroku procesu spouštění. Není přitom vůbec nutné je všechny provádět třeba v jednom dni. Nezapomeňte také vždy po několika měsících dobu spouštění počítače zkontrolovat, protože kupříkladu po instalaci nových aplikací se může doba znovu prodloužit.